    Hi folks, my laptop finally spat the dummy (pacifier) and need to buy a new one to operate my 2 x 4. Will a Windows 10 be compatible or do I need the Windows 7 again, it was originally running on Vista.
    32 bit 64 bit? any one know?

    64 bit would be best if you are using Cad version 7 and above. TM3 and 4 can both run on 64 bit, Windows 10 is fine as well.
